When shopping for a picture frame for 9 photos, one of the most critical specifications is the opening size. A huge number of these frames are designed for the standard 4x6 inch print, leading to the common search for a 9 picture collage frame 4x6 or a 9 opening 4x6 picture frame. This size is practical and economical, as 4x6 prints are easy and inexpensive to produce from digital files. Before purchasing, always double-check the listed opening dimensions. Some frames may have openings that are slightly smaller than 4x6 to accommodate a border around the print, requiring you to trim your photos. A true picture frame with 9-4x6 openings will specify that the openings themselves are 4x6, ensuring a perfect fit for your standard prints.

Beyond size, consider the frame's construction and style. Materials range from sleek metals like brushed nickel to warm woods and modern acrylics. The matting—the border inside each opening—is another key feature. A white or off-white mat is classic and helps each photo stand out, while a black or colored mat can create a more dramatic, unified look. The depth of the frame is also important; deeper frames can often accommodate slightly thicker materials or prints that aren't perfectly flat.
